Transaction 575105972042e268c1cbd3211fc468fa47f35761d97e5a01253a18bb3877a561
2 Input
2 Outputs
- 575105972042e268c1cbd3211fc468fa47f35761d97e5a01253a18bb3877a561:0
- 575105972042e268c1cbd3211fc468fa47f35761d97e5a01253a18bb3877a561:1
value 26635
address 1HNKCaM4gd7tWYRNUji2HefyE9Mwrka2bX
value 15800000
address 1ErnHxPkRnE6DxWQ3VCT5VrZP96sxyGvby